Searched refs:reorder_access (Results 1 – 4 of 4) sorted by relevance
397 if (!reorder_access) in find_reorder_access()404 return reorder_access->ptr == ptr && reorder_access->size == size && in find_reorder_access()405 reorder_access->type == type && reorder_access->ip == ip; in find_reorder_access()424 reorder_access->ptr = ptr; in set_reorder_access()427 reorder_access->ip = ip; in set_reorder_access()751 if (reorder_access) { in check_access()758 ip = reorder_access->ip; in check_access()1110 if (!reorder_access) in __tsan_func_exit()1121 check_access(reorder_access->ptr, reorder_access->size, in __tsan_func_exit()1122 reorder_access->type, reorder_access->ip); in __tsan_func_exit()[all …]
113 struct kcsan_scoped_access *reorder_access = ¤t->kcsan_ctx.reorder_access; in test_barrier() local115 struct kcsan_scoped_access *reorder_access = NULL; in test_barrier()122 if (!reorder_access || !IS_ENABLED(CONFIG_SMP)) in test_barrier()127 reorder_access->type = (access_type) | KCSAN_ACCESS_SCOPED; \ in test_barrier()128 reorder_access->size = 1; \ in test_barrier()130 if (reorder_access->size != 0) { \ in test_barrier()
528 struct kcsan_scoped_access *reorder_access = ¤t->kcsan_ctx.reorder_access; in test_barrier_nothreads() local530 struct kcsan_scoped_access *reorder_access = NULL; in test_barrier_nothreads()535 KCSAN_TEST_REQUIRES(test, reorder_access != NULL); in test_barrier_nothreads()540 reorder_access->type = (access_type) | KCSAN_ACCESS_SCOPED; \ in test_barrier_nothreads()541 reorder_access->size = sizeof(test_var); \ in test_barrier_nothreads()543 KUNIT_EXPECT_EQ_MSG(test, reorder_access->size, \ in test_barrier_nothreads()562 while (test_var++ < 1000000 && reorder_access->size != sizeof(test_var)) in test_barrier_nothreads()564 KUNIT_ASSERT_EQ(test, reorder_access->size, sizeof(test_var)); in test_barrier_nothreads()
60 struct kcsan_scoped_access reorder_access; member
Completed in 14 milliseconds